Cloud-Based Systems

Internet-based services have transformed the way companies utilize their phone systems. Unlike traditional business phone systems that require significant hardware installation, cloud-based alternatives allow companies to manage their calls over the cloud. This adaptability enables businesses to scale their operations quickly and smoothly, making it easier to respond to shifting business needs.

With cloud-based telephone systems, features such as message recording, call redirection, and group calls can be managed from any location. Staff can access the system using their mobile devices, portable computers, or any online device, ensuring that dialogue remains seamless, whether operating from the workplace or off-site. This flexibility enhances productivity and fosters better cooperation among groups.

Additionally, internet-dependent business communication services often come with decreased preliminary costs and predictable monthly billing. This model not only lowers the initial investment but also minimizes the need for ongoing support and upgrades. With regular updates and enhanced security features, companies can focus on their primary operations while enjoying the benefits of a modern telephone system.

Advanced Phone Management

Advanced call management is essential for contemporary business phone systems, allowing companies to enhance their communication efficiency. Features such as forwarding calls, routing calls, and queuing calls help ensure that customer questions are directed to the right departments or individuals avoiding unnecessary delay. These capabilities not only improve response times but also boost customer satisfaction, making it essential for businesses striving to maintain a market advantage.

Another notable aspect of enhanced call management is the integration of analytical tools and analysis tools within commercial telephone systems. These tools provide understanding into call volumes, peak call times, and individual performance metrics. Lastly, features such as email delivery of voicemails and call capturing further improve the utility of business phone systems. Voicemail-to-email ensures that no message goes ignored, allowing employees to react to urgent issues quickly, even when out of the workplace. Recording calls facilitates educational purposes and quality assurance, providing a resource for review and feedback. By leveraging these enhanced tools, businesses can refine their communication strategies and develop stronger relationships with their stakeholders.

Connecting with Enterprise Tools

Integrating company phone systems with current enterprise tools is crucial for enhancing productivity and streamlining communication. Modern enterprise phones offer smooth connectivity with customer relationship management systems, email platforms, and project management tools. This integration allows for the automatic of calls, enhancing record-keeping and enabling rapid access to pertinent customer information during discussions.

In addition, a efficiently integrated telephone system can facilitate advanced features such as click-to-call, where users can start calls directly from their business applications. This not only saves time but also minimizes errors associated with manually dialing numbers. Furthermore, having a unified system where all communication channels are interconnected ensures that employees can collaborate more effectively, regardless of their geographical location.

Finally, the capability to utilize data analytics from integrated tools helps businesses gain insights into interpersonal patterns and customer interactions. This information can be extremely valuable for enhancing customer service and identifying opportunities for expansion. By adopting a business telephone system that readily integrates with tools already in use, companies can maximize their efficiency and improve overall operational performance.
